Understanding Anxiety
Anxiety is a complex emotional response characterized by feelings of tension, worry, and physical changes such as increased blood pressure. Recognizing its symptoms and causes is essential for effective management. Furthermore, anxiety can significantly impact daily life, affecting personal relationships, work performance, and overall well-being.
Symptoms and Causes
Anxiety manifests through a variety of symptoms. Common physical symptoms include:
- Increased heart rate
- Sweating
- Trembling
- Fatigue
- Muscle tension
It can also present with emotional symptoms such as excessive worry, irritability, and difficulty concentrating.
The causes of anxiety are multifaceted. They may include genetic predisposition, environmental factors, and significant life events. Neurotransmitter imbalances and certain medical conditions can also contribute. Understanding these underlying factors is crucial for effective treatment and support.
Effects on Daily Life
Anxiety can profoundly affect daily functioning. At work, it may lead to decreased productivity and difficulty concentrating. Individuals may find themselves avoiding meetings or slipping deadlines due to fear of judgment.
In personal relationships, anxiety can create barriers to effective communication. This may lead to misunderstandings or feelings of isolation. Social situations can become overwhelming, resulting in withdrawal from friends and family.
In everyday scenarios, anxiety can affect routine activities. Simple tasks, like grocery shopping or attending social events, might become sources of stress. Recognizing these impacts is vital for seeking appropriate support and interventions.
Online Anxiety Counselling
Online anxiety counselling provides individuals with convenient access to mental health support from the comfort of their homes. It combines technology with therapy, offering various options for those experiencing anxiety.
How It Works
Online anxiety counselling typically involves video calls, phone calls, or text messaging. Clients can choose a platform that best suits their needs. Sessions are scheduled at convenient times, making this form of therapy more adaptable to busy lifestyles.
Initially, clients may undergo an assessment to discuss their anxiety symptoms and treatment goals. This helps the counselor tailor the therapy effectively. Sessions may include c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) techniques, mindfulness exercises, and therapeutic conversations to enable coping strategies.
Benefits of Online Therapy
Online therapy offers several advantages. Convenience is a significant factor, as clients can attend sessions without traveling. This saves time and reduces the stress associated with visiting a physical location.
Additionally, clients might experience increased comfort in their personal environment, which can facilitate open discussions. Privacy is another benefit; individuals may feel more secure sharing their thoughts online.
Flexibility in scheduling allows for a greater chance of consistent attendance, which is crucial in therapy. Online counselling also opens doors to specialists who may not be available locally, expanding access to quality resources.
Choosing the Right Counselor
Selecting a suitable counselor for online anxiety therapy is essential. Credentials and experience should be primary considerations. Look for licensed professionals with expertise in treating anxiety disorders.
Another factor is comfort and rapport. It’s important for clients to feel at ease with their counselor. Many platforms offer introductory sessions, allowing individuals to assess the fit before committing.
Additionally, consider specialization in techniques such as CBT or mindfulness, which may align with the client’s preferences. Evaluating client reviews and recommendations can also provide insights into the effectiveness of the therapist’s approach.
